ASEAN Economic Forum – Research Project on Trade in Services

Countries of the Association of South East Asian Nations (ASEAN) are engaged in international trade negotiations in a variety of forums.  Governments that are members of the WTO participate in the multilateral Doha Development Agenda (DDA).  Laos and Vietnam are in the process of negotiating accession to the WTO.  All ASEAN countries negotiate services under the ASEAN Framework Agreement on Services (AFAS) and additional negotiations have been launched between ASEAN and other Asian countries (e.g., China, India).  Moreover, individual countries are engaged in bilateral negotiations with countries outside the region (e.g., Malaysia, Singapore, and Thailand).

Effective participation in these negotiations requires that governments are well-informed about own export interests and the implications of opening service markets to foreign competition.  The World Bank Institute is supporting the ASEAN Economic Forum—a group of economic researchers from the ASEAN region—to strengthen the analytical foundation on which policymakers can base the negotiation of international trade commitments.
